In response to the urgent need in  accelerating TB cases finding, notification and treatment, the Ministry  of Health has initiated a District Public Private  Mix (DPPM) model, a concept in which health facilities and providers  collaborating in a district are network, involving all professional and  community organization under the leadership of the District Health  Office (DHO).
USAID commits to support the National TB  Program (NTP), including in accelerating TB case finding, treatment and  notification nationwide through the DPPM  approach.
